Sewing Hope, the book

by Reggie Whitten and Nancy Henderson

Sewing Hope tells the story of one woman's fight to restore hope to her nation. Sister Rosemary Nyirumbe presides over Saint Monica's Vocational School in Gulu, Uganda. She lived through the horror created by Joseph Kony's LRA and now works to heal the wounds he inflicted on her people.
